The CDC has issued a mandatory quarantine due to an unknown virus that is spreading like wildfire among the population. There is a raising suspicion that the vaccine resides in the same facility that you and your team have been quarantined in... Do you have what it takes to find the vaccine, and escape alive, before your time runs out?
Reviews
No reviews